Technically, PiaM, negative friction means that resistance increases as load decreases (TLDR: it sucks you in), which has absolutely nothing to do with what Marlin is doing; if you don't have friction you literally can't move at all, because you slip off every time you push against something. So speaking in terms of physics he's, to quote Wolfgang Pauli, not even wrong.
